Extracorporeal Therapy (Dialysis)

Extracorporeal therapy is a procedure that removes blood from the body, circulates it through a filter system and then returns that blood back to the body. In veterinary medicine this encompasses Hemodialysis (HD), Hemoperfusion (HP) ...
